The ecology and distribution of the rodents of northern Mohave County, Arizona

Darden TR. 1965. The ecology and distribution of the rodents of northern Mohave County, Arizona. University of Arizona

This thesis described the geology, climate, “life zones” and associated flora for 27 known species of rodents in an area bounded by the Arizona border to the west and north, the Mohave/Coconino County line to the east and the Grand Canyon to the south. Distribution of rodents is postulated to be affected by soil type more than plant type.
